I bought a D grade 16 from RI. It was not well described; it had been restocked among other things. That said, I kept it as it is near the top of my list of Parkers that are 'deadly'.....it is a gun that seems to not mind if you did your job properly or not. It connects with just about every shot. It was also a good deal, restocked or not. But, RI has a long way to go before they approach Julia's.

I have bid on a number of guns on the site. The last one I got was an Ithaca Magnum 10. they had it listed as a 4E but I could tell from the pictures that it was not. I got it for a good price. They do not describe the guns well but if you call with specifics they will give you an answer.
